KeyMission 360/170 Utility Description

  • Updating the folder tree:
  • Folders created using the file explorer, etc., of other applications after starting this application will not be visible in this application's folder tree. To update the folder tree, this application must be restarted.
  • Reading files from the camera:
  • When reading data with a large file size, it may take some time before the image is displayed.
  • Omnidirectional image display:
  • Depending on the performance of your graphics card, omnidirectional still images may not be displayed correctly. For example, they may be white or in monochrome. Updating your driver may improve performance. For information about updating your driver, contact your computer manufacturer, retailer, etc.
  • Split-screen image display:
  • When viewing omnidirectional images in a split-screen display, the cross mark displayed in the position guide indicates the center of the left image.
  • Playing movies:
  • Even in recommended environments, depending on the performance of your graphics card, movies recorded at the movie settings 3840×2160 or 3840×1920 (KeyMission 360 only) may not play smoothly.
  • During effect preview playback, movies recorded at the movie settings 3840×2160 or 3840×1920 (KeyMission 360 only) may not play back smoothly. However, the output movie will do so.
  • If you resize the screen during movie playback, the screen may turn black and playback may temporarily stop.
  • Once resizing is complete, playback will begin.
  • Saving files:
  • If the format of the destination drive is FAT32, movies that are larger than 4 GB cannot be saved.
  • Resolution settings:
  • Depending on the resolution settings, part of the app may be concealed.
  • Set the Windows Taskbar or Mac Dock to "AutoHide."
  • Highlight tags:
  • On movies shot with KeyMission 360 or KeyMission 170, the camera automatically adds highlight tags 2 seconds after the start and 2 seconds before the end of the movie. Even if you create a movie using highlight tags, the movie at these positions will not be created as a highlight movie.
